Inhibition of non-quantal acetylcholine leakage by 2(4-phenylpiperidine)cyclohexanol in the mouse diaphragm
Authors:F Vyskocil
Affiliation:Institute of Physiology, Czechoslovak Academy of Sciences, Viden?ská 1083, 142 20 Prague 4-Kr? Czechoslovakia
Abstract:The drug 2(4-phenylpiperidine)cyclohexanol (AH 5183) caused hyperpolarization by 1.8 +/- 0.6 mV in an end-plate zone of mouse diaphragm fibers without any change in the amplitude of miniature end-plate potentials. This supports the idea that the drug inhibits the non-quantal leakage from motor nerve terminals, probably at those parts of the nerve terminals which were incorporated into the terminal membrane after vesicle exocytosis.
Keywords:acetylcholine  non-quantal release  end-plate potential  2(4-phenylpiperidine)cyclohexanol  mouse
